Providing Psychosocial Support in the Aftermath of Tropical Storm Erika

Image of collapsed house in the aftermath of a natural disaster

August 2015 saw the Commonwealth of Dominica devastated by tropical storm Erika, which left in her wake 30 direct deaths and significant destruction of infrastructure. The Ministry of Social Services, Family and Gender Affairs in Dominica, requested the assistance of the Social Work Unit of the University of the West Indies (UWI).
